SendableChooser generic value (#433)

* Java SendableChooser now decorates with type (non-breaking change)

* C++ SendableChooser now is templated on the type instead of using void* and stores values (breaking change)

* C++ SendableChooser now uses llvm::StringMap instead of std::map
